Lime Syrup

Recipe information

  • Yield

    <p> <lb>Makes 2 1/2 cups.<pb/></lb></p>

Ingredients

2 cups sugar
the grated rind from 4 limes

Preparation

  1. In a saucepan combine the sugar with 2 cups water, bring the water to a boil over moderate heat, stirring until the sugar is dissolved, and add the lime rind. Cook the syrup, undisturbed, for 10 minutes. Let the syrup cool until it is lukewarm and strain it into a jar, pressing hard on the rind with the back of a spoon. The syrup keeps indefinitely, covered and chilled.
